📏 Size Guide: Find Your Fit
🔹 The Micro Series (2mm & 3mm)
BEST FOR: Puffco Proxy, Dr. Dabber Switch, TinyMight 2
In compact chambers, space is a luxury. A common mistake is using a pearl that is too big, which causes clogging. A 3mm Ruby Pearl is the limit here. They spin at incredibly high RPMs in tight spaces.
🏆 The Golden Standard (4mm)
BEST FOR: Puffco Peak Pro (3D/3DXL), Carta 2, Core 2.0
If you own a modern e-rig, 4mm is the industry standard. It creates the perfect amount of agitation. When paired with a joystick cap, it ensures you get every last milligram of vapor.
🌪️ The Workhorse (6mm)
BEST FOR: Standard 25mm / 30mm Quartz Bangers
For traditional torch users, the 6mm Ruby Pearl is the classic choice. When used with a Spinner Cap, they carry enough momentum to spin vigorously even as the banger cools down.
💎 The Heavyweights (8mm - 16mm)
BEST FOR: Slurpers, Control Towers, Blenders
Mids (8-12mm): Bounce inside the pillar.
Valves (14-16mm): Large ruby spheres that sit on top to seal the vacuum.
⚖️ Quantity: Less is More
E-Rigs: Stick to 1 pearl. Two pearls often collide and kill the spin.
Quartz Bangers: 1 or 2 pearls are ideal. Two pearls create a "tornado" effect.
⚠️ Critical Warning
Ruby is harder than quartz, but it is susceptible to Thermal Shock.
- The Golden Rule: NEVER drop a hot ruby pearl directly into cold ISO alcohol. It will crack.
- Cleaning: Wait for the pearl to cool down naturally (below 200°F) before soaking.
